目錄 數據庫的存儲引擎 什么是存儲引擎? mysql支持哪些存儲引擎? 各種存儲引擎的特性 常用存儲引擎及適用場景 查詢當前數據庫支持的存儲引擎: mysql> show engines \G ...
存儲引擎的選擇 不同的存儲引擎都有各自的特點,從而適應不同的需求,如下表所示: 接下來,我們逐一簡單介紹一下。 存儲引擎詳解 插件式的存儲引擎設計是 MySQL 區別於其他數據庫的一個重要特性,MySQL 的核心在於存儲引擎。 存儲引擎索引原理對比 MyISAM 索引原理 MyISAM 引擎使用B Tree作為索引結構,葉節點的 data 域存放的是 數據記錄的地址 。下圖是MyISAM索引的原理 ...
2021-06-28 08:39 0 360 推薦指數:
目錄 數據庫的存儲引擎 什么是存儲引擎? mysql支持哪些存儲引擎? 各種存儲引擎的特性 常用存儲引擎及適用場景 查詢當前數據庫支持的存儲引擎: mysql> show engines \G ...
進擊のpython ***** 數據庫——存儲引擎 上一節在表的操作的最后一點,提到了一個設置存儲引擎 那什么是存儲引擎呢?存儲引擎能用來干什么? 這就是本小節所要研究的問題了 存儲引擎 庫就是創建了一個文件夾,在文件夾里存儲的文件就叫表 那根據生活常識應該知道 ...
原文來自:MySQL數據庫的各種存儲引擎詳解 MySQL有多種存儲引擎,每種存儲引擎有各自的優缺點,大家可以擇優選擇使用: MyISAM、InnoDB、MERGE、MEMORY(HEAP)、BDB(BerkeleyDB)、EXAMPLE、FEDERATED、ARCHIVE、CSV ...
一、關系型數據庫與非關系型數據庫 1.關系型數據庫的特點: 1)數據以表格的形式出現 2)每行為各種記錄名稱 3)每列為記錄名稱所對應的數據域 4)許多的行和列組成一張表單 5)若干的表單組成數據庫 2.關系型數據庫的優勢: 2.1 復雜的查詢:可以使 ...
數據庫存儲引擎是數據庫底層軟件組織,數據庫管理系統(DBMS)使用數據引擎進行創建、查詢、更新和刪除數據。不同的存儲引擎提供不同的存儲機制、索引技巧、鎖定水平等功能,使用不同的存儲引擎,還可以獲得特定的功能。現在許多不同的數據庫管理系統都支持多種不同的數據引擎。MySQL的核心就是存儲引擎 ...
數據庫存儲引擎是數據庫底層軟件組織,數據庫管理系統(DBMS)使用數據引擎進行創建、查詢、更新和刪除數據。不同的存儲引擎提供不同的存儲機制、索引技巧、鎖定水平等功能,使用不同的存儲引擎,還可以 獲得特定的功能。現在許多不同的數據庫管理系統都支持多種不同的數據引擎。MySQL的核心就是存儲引擎 ...
如何將mysql數據庫中的MyISAM類型表更改為InnoDB類型的表 改單個表 改多個表 #修改為MyISAM 使用說明: 1. 將以上SQL語句中的 DBNAME 替換成需要修改的數據庫名稱。 2. 執行SQL ...
指定使用mysql數據庫,並指定默認存儲引擎 "OPTIONS": {"init_command": "SET storage_engine=INNODB;"} 會報錯,正確的解決辦法為: ...